[20p-431B-6] Fast calculation method of wide viewing-zone computer-generated hologram with a parabolic mirror by area segmentation

Yusuke Sando3, Daisuke Barada1,2, Toyohiko Yatagai1 (1.CORE, Utsunomiya Univ., 2.Grad. Sch. Eng., Utsunomiya Univ., 3.ORIST)

Keywords:holographic 3D display, computer-generated hologram, holographic stereogram

We propose a fast calculation method for a holographic 3D display using a convex parabolic mirror by area segmentation. This treatment enables paraxial approximation and fast Fourier transform by limiting the hologram area to be calculated. The depth information of a 3D object is considered every segmented sub-hologram, At the boundary area, continuity of wavefronts has been maintained, and the quality of the reconstructed image has improved.
